ANNONA
MURICATA - Soursop, Guanabana
A
small, upright evergreen which cannot stand frost. It may be grown only
in warmest parts of Florida or in greenhouses. The leaves are dark green
and glossy. The fruit is 6-9", yellow green in color, with white
flesh. The pulp is excellent for making drinks and sherbets and, though
slightly sour-acid, can be eaten out-of-hand.
